是的,1核2G的云服务器完全可以支持大多数个人应用,尤其适合轻量级、低并发的使用场景。是否足够取决于你的具体应用类型和访问量。
一、适合运行的应用类型(1核2G足够):
-
个人博客或网站
- 使用 WordPress、Typecho、Hugo 等搭建的静态或动态博客。
- 日均访问量在几百到几千 PV 的情况下运行良好。
-
小型Web应用
- 基于 Node.js、Python(Flask/Django)、PHP 等开发的轻量级后台服务。
- 配合 Nginx + MySQL/MariaDB 可以运行基本的全栈应用。
-
API 服务
- 提供 RESTful 或 GraphQL 接口,供个人项目调用。
- 并发请求不高时性能稳定。
-
学习与开发环境
- 搭建 Linux 学习环境、Docker 容器实验、Git 服务器等。
- 编译简单项目、部署测试应用非常合适。
-
自动化脚本 / 定时任务
- 如爬虫、数据同步、监控脚本等后台任务。
-
轻量级数据库
- 运行 MySQL、PostgreSQL 或 SQLite,用于小规模数据存储。
-
反向X_X / X_X中转
- 配置 Nginx、Caddy 或 frp 中继服务。
二、可能受限的场景(1核2G不够)
- 高并发访问:如日活用户上千、瞬时大量请求。
- 视频/图片处理:需要大量 CPU 和内存进行转码或分析。
- 大型数据库:数据量大、频繁查询的场景可能导致内存不足。
- Java 应用:Spring Boot 默认占用内存较高,需优化 JVM 参数。
- 机器学习模型推理:需要 GPU 或更多内存。
三、优化建议(提升1核2G性能)
-
使用轻量级系统和服务
- 操作系统:推荐 Alpine Linux、Ubuntu Server LTS(最小安装)。
- Web服务器:Nginx 比 Apache 更省资源。
- 数据库:SQLite 或 MariaDB 调优配置。
-
启用 Swap 分区
- 增加 1~2GB Swap,防止内存不足导致进程被杀。
-
关闭不必要的服务
- 如蓝牙、打印、GUI 桌面环境等。
-
使用缓存机制
- Redis 缓存热点数据,减轻数据库压力(注意内存分配)。
-
定期监控资源
- 使用
htop、free -h、df -h监控 CPU、内存、磁盘使用情况。
- 使用
四、性价比建议
目前主流云厂商(阿里云、腾讯云、华为云、AWS、DigitalOcean)都有提供 1核2G 的入门级实例,价格通常在:
- 国内:约 ¥20~50/月(新用户优惠更低)
- 海外:$5/月 左右(如 DigitalOcean、Linode)
非常适合学生、开发者、自由职业者作为起步服务器。
✅ 总结
对于绝大多数个人项目,1核2G云服务器完全够用,只要合理配置和优化,可以稳定运行博客、Web应用、API服务等。
若未来流量增长,可随时升级配置或迁移至更高规格实例。
如果你告诉我你的具体应用(比如“我想搭一个 WordPress 博客”或“跑一个 Python 爬虫+数据库”),我可以给出更精确的建议 😊
秒懂云